NEW Prison Break Results (8/16)

Jon Moxley vs. Pentagon Jr.

- Early crowd brawling took the crowd out of it because no one, even those watching at home, could see it. Once they got back to ringside, the match picked up. Moxley kicked out the Package Piledriver, took off Penta's mask, and hit Paradigm Shift for the win. Moxley looked a little worn out for the G1 run and travel. Plus, he may have tweaked his ankle. They agreed to a rematch at some point in AEW. 

ROH World Championship: Matt Taven def. JT Dunn

Fenix was Dunn's original opponent, but travel issues kept him off the show. Taven was the mystery opponent and decided to put the ROH World Title on the line. Both guys worked hard and Taven was giving, making Dunn look good. Crowd was into it, even chanting "This is awesome" at one point. Taven won with the Frog Splash. 

NEW Championship - No DQ: Darby Allin (c) def. Hale Collins

- Both men went crashing through tables on the floor. Allin missed a diving elbow from the top rope and Collins topped him by missing a diving elbow off a ladder. Match seemed way too short. Allin retained with the Trust Fall. A fan hit Allin in the  face with a Pepsi after the match and Allin looked ready to kill him. Fortunately, security took him away.

nZo (the former Enzo Amore) def. Brian Pillman Jr.

- Match went way too long given one competitor involved. nZo took the majority of the match and didn't look great. He came out looking depressed instead of his usual fired up self. Crowd wasn't into the majority of the match. They cheer when it was over then quickly booed the result. nZo took the victory with Eat Defeat.

NEW Tag Team Championships: Jerry Lawler & Keith Youngblood (c) def. David Arquette & King Brian Anthony

- Youngblood and King Brian worked most of the match. The Duke of Danger came in and attacked Youngblood and Lawler, leading to "The Man Scout" Jake Manning making the save. Lawler hit a backdrop and weak looking Fistdrop on Arquette for the win. Crowd booed the finish. King Brian attacked Arquette after the match. Lawler made the save, hitting a Stunner on King Brian. Arquette followed with a Diamond Cutter. Arquette and Lawler shake hands after the match.

CaZXL (the former Big Cass) def. Thrillride

- Crowd was so into the match they had dueling "We want Enzo" "No we don't" chants. CaZXL looked fine but it was overbooked with interference by Jared Silberkliet and Ron Zombie. CaZXL won with a Powerbomb. 

Wrecking Ball Legursky def. Mike Verna

- They tried but both men have a long way to go. Crowd was into chanting "Wrecking Ball" at least. Wrecking Ball won after a catch Bossman Slam. 

Penelope Ford def. Tasha Steelz

- Competitive match. Ford won with a Handspring Cutter. 

Private Party (Isiah Kassidy & Marq Quen) def. Inzanely Rude (RJ Rude & Zane Bernardo) and A Boy and His Dinosaur (Jungle Boy & Luchasaurus)
